Paver Driveway Installation
A paver driveway makes an immediate statement about your home. Unlike poured concrete that cracks over time or asphalt that requires frequent resealing, interlocking pavers flex with the ground and can handle heavy vehicle loads without damage.
Our driveway installations use a reinforced aggregate base specifically engineered for vehicular traffic. We select pavers rated for the weight and stress of daily use, and every installation includes proper edge restraints to prevent lateral movement. The result is a driveway that looks exceptional on day one and remains structurally sound for 25 years or more.

Retaining Wall Construction
Retaining walls solve drainage problems, prevent erosion, and create usable flat areas on sloped properties. Our team specializes in Rosetta stone retaining walls, a premium natural-look system that combines beauty with structural performance.
We engineer every retaining wall based on the height, soil type, and drainage conditions specific to your property. Walls over four feet in height include geogrid reinforcement, proper backfill drainage aggregate, and engineered footings. Whether you need a functional wall to manage a grade change or a decorative feature to define garden spaces, we build it to last.

Hardscaping FAQs
Retaining wall costs in Iowa typically range from $25 to $50 per square face foot for standard block walls, and $40 to $75 per square face foot for premium natural stone systems like Rosetta. A typical 50-linear-foot wall that is 3 feet tall costs between $4,000 and $12,000 depending on the materials, height, and site conditions. Taller walls requiring engineering and geogrid reinforcement will be on the higher end. We provide detailed, itemized estimates for every project so there are no surprises.
Standard concrete block retaining walls are the most affordable option, typically costing $25-35 per square face foot installed. While timber walls may appear cheaper initially, they have a much shorter lifespan (10-15 years versus 50+ years for block or stone) and often require replacement sooner. At Matthias Landscaping, we help clients find the best value by recommending materials that balance upfront cost with long-term durability. A properly built block wall may cost slightly more than timber but will last three to four times longer.
Natural stone and engineered concrete block systems like Rosetta are the most durable retaining wall materials available. Both can last 50 years or more when properly installed with adequate drainage and base preparation. Rosetta stone in particular is a popular choice because it provides the natural look of real stone with the structural consistency of an engineered system. The key to longevity is not just the wall material itself but the quality of the base, backfill drainage, and compaction, which is why professional installation matters.
Timeline depends on the scope of the project. A standard paver patio of 300-500 square feet typically takes 3-5 working days. A paver driveway may take 5-7 days. Larger projects that combine multiple elements, such as a patio with retaining wall, fire pit, and walkways, can take 2-3 weeks.
